Removal of phenols from mixtures by co-immobilized laccase/tyrosinase and Polyclar adsorption

An enzymatic method for removal of phenols from their mixtures was investigated. Phenols in an aqueous solution were removed after a two-step treatment with co-immobilized laccase and tyrosinase and Polyclar (polyvinylpolypyrrolidone). A laccase from Pyricularia oryrae and mushroom tyrosinase were co-immobilized on Mikroperl in a fixed-bed tubular bioreactor by a rapid and simple method. The support immobilized 95% of the total laccase units and 35% of the total tyrosinase units. Different mixtures of phenols were passed through the column with co-immobilized laccase and tyrosinase, This method removed 42-90% of different phenolic substances by a single passage through the bioreactor, The second step employed Polyclar for additional removal of phenolic substances from mixtures. The degree of removal depends on the nature of the phenols. Complete removal was achieved for alpha-naphthol, 2,4-dichlorophenol, 4-methoxyphenol, beta-naphthol, 4-chloro-3-methylphenol and catehin. The operational stability of the immobilized system was 10-90 h depending on the substrate. The biocatalyst was capable of continuous transformation of different phenols in mixtures.
